A greenhouse is a structure that is made of transparent material, such as glass or plastic and is used to grow plants. The transparent material allows sunlight to enter the greenhouse, which warms the air and the soil. This allows plants to grow even in cold weather.
Greenhouses work on the principle of the greenhouse effect. The greenhouse effect is the process by which gases in Earth's atmosphere trap heat from the sun. This heat keeps Earth's temperature warm enough to support life.
In a greenhouse, the transparent material traps heat from the sun, just like the gases in Earth's atmosphere. This heat keeps the air and the soil in the greenhouse warm, which allows plants to grow even in cold weather.
Greenhouses are used for many different purposes. They are used by commercial growers to produce fruits and vegetables, and they are also used by hobbyists to grow plants for their own enjoyment.
Greenhouses can also be used for scientific research. They can be used to study the effects of different environmental conditions on plant growth.

A greenhouse is a structure that is used to grow plants in a controlled environment. Greenhouses trap heat from the sun, which allows plants to grow even in cold weather.
Greenhouses are made of glass or plastic, which allows sunlight to pass through. The glass or plastic also traps heat, which keeps the greenhouse warm. The heat is trapped because the glass or plastic is transparent to visible light but opaque to infrared radiation. Visible light from the sun passes through the glass or plastic and is absorbed by the plants. The plants then release infrared radiation, which is trapped by the glass or plastic. This keeps the greenhouse warm.
Greenhouses can be used to grow a variety of plants, including vegetables, fruits, flowers, and herbs. They are also used to grow plants that would not be able to survive in the cold winter weather, such as tropical plants.
